It's not unusual in vintage equipment to have multi-purpose garden machines. This one is
unusual in that in is an Australian made mower and digger designed for smaller blocks -
and it dates from 1959.

There is little information on the machine at this time. However, I do know it was designed
and manufactured by Byers Engineering Company of 43 Evans Street, Fairfield, Sydney,
and then at 219 Canley Vale Road, Canley Heights, Sydney.

This machine should not be confused with another machine - also called the 'Little Digger',
manufactured by Rotary Hoes of England and sold here in the mid-1950s. That machine was a
larger machine, which had attachments including a reel mower.

The Australian 'Little Digger' was a rotary lawnmower with a vertical shaft engine!
